Empezar
EmpezarGestionar la memoria

Gestionar la memoria

Gato AI Translations for Polylang requiere que tu servidor PHP tenga un límite máximo de 512MB de memoria o superior.

Si tu servidor no proporciona esta cantidad de memoria, el plugin no se cargará.

Alerta de límite de memoria del plugin
Alerta de límite de memoria del plugin

Esta restricción evita que el servidor se quede sin memoria al ejecutar traducciones intensivas (p. ej.: al traducir muchas entradas a la vez, a varios idiomas).

Comprobar la memoria disponible

Para conocer la memoria disponible, ve a la pantalla Herramientas > Salud del sitio, y en la pestaña Información, comprueba el valor de Servidor > Límite de memoria PHP:

Comprobando el límite de memoria PHP en Salud del sitio de WordPress
Comprobando el límite de memoria PHP en Salud del sitio de WordPress

Aumentar el límite de memoria

Para aumentar el límite máximo de memoria en WordPress, es posible que necesites:

  • Aumentar el límite de memoria en el panel de control de tu proveedor de hosting
  • Aumentar el límite de memoria en WordPress añadiendo el siguiente código al archivo wp-config.php:
if ( !defined('WP_MEMORY_LIMIT') ) {
  define( 'WP_MEMORY_LIMIT', '1G' ); // 1GB
}
if ( !defined('WP_MAX_MEMORY_LIMIT') ) {
  define( 'WP_MAX_MEMORY_LIMIT', '1G' ); // 1GB for admin dashboard
}

Si tras estos pasos el límite de memoria no ha aumentado, consulta con tu proveedor de hosting.

Avanzado: Sobrescribir la memoria requerida por el plugin

Si no necesitas traducir varias entradas a la vez, o si tus entradas no son muy largas, puedes establecer un valor inferior para la memoria requerida.

Para hacerlo, define la constante GATO_MLP_REQUIRED_MAX_MEMORY en wp-config.php:

// Override the memory required by the plugin, from 512MB to 256MB
define('GATO_MLP_REQUIRED_MAX_MEMORY', '256M');

En este ejemplo, el plugin se cargará si el servidor dispone de un límite máximo de 256MB de memoria.